About Iron Horse Vineyards

Iron Horse Vineyards is a dedicated estate winery in the cool, fog-dominated Green Valley sub-appellation within the Russian River Valley, producing wines that reflect the character of Goldridge sandy loam soils and the deepest, most persistent fog of any Russian River Valley sub-zone. Iron Horse Vineyards is based in Green Valley, with its visitor experience rooted in the Russian River Valley wine regio. The estate's commitment to quality viticulture and site-specific winemaking has earned Iron Horse Vineyards a respected place among the region's most consistent and genuinely food-friendly producers.

The Green Valley of Russian River Valley growing environment shapes everything Iron Horse Vineyards produces. Goldridge sandy loam soils and the deepest, most persistent fog of any russian river valley sub-zone define the estate's vineyard character, contributing the structure, natural acidity, and terroir specificity that distinguish the finest wines from this appellation. Pinot Noir and Chardonnay form the backbone of the portfolio, with each variety expressing a distinct facet of the estate's unique growing conditions. Winemaking at Iron Horse Vineyards prioritizes transparency and balance over extraction, allowing the appellation's natural character to lead rather than winemaker intervention.

Featured Wines

Sparkling (Pinot Noir/Chardonnay)
Wedding Cuvée
Green Valley Estate
The Iron Horse signature — a méthode champenoise blend of estate Pinot Noir and Chardonnay that has been poured at White House celebrations for decades. Elegant, complex, and genuinely world-class.

Sparkling (Chardonnay)
Blanc de Blancs
Green Valley Estate
100% estate Green Valley Chardonnay — showing the mineral precision and cool-climate freshness of one of California's finest cool-climate sparkling wine sites.
